GRANTS of up to €200,000 are available for Limerick projects with strong built heritage conservation objectives and clear public or community benefit.

Interested applicants should contact their local authority’s Architectural Conservation office. Minister for Housing, Local Government, and Heritage, James Browne, and the Minister of State for Nature, Heritage, and Biodiversity, Christopher O’Sullivan, launched the Historic Structures Fund (HSF) for 2026.

With over €3.5million in funding allocated to 28 projects in 2025, the 2026 scheme will support the repair, maintenance, and rejuvenation of historic structures in all local authority areas, honouring their past and safeguarding them into the future.
